The Scrum Manager helps in the running and achievement of agile projects in an organisation. Their key function is to be a ‘process owner’ whose major role is to ensure that Scrum is properly adopted, and the implementation is done properly by the team. They coordinate processes eradicating anything that may slow down the work of the team as well as creating an atmosphere of togetherness. What is required is not just following the timeline but strategically organising the project. A Scrum Manager is capable of establishing a streamlined and highly efficient workflow through the implementation of Scrum principles. They orchestrate the framework of a project into sprints with clear objectives, ideal timelines, and deliverables; this gives them the clarity needed to focus on smaller goals as they build towards that larger end-all. A Scrum Manager performs duties like daily stand-ups, sprint planning, retrospective sessions, etc. This will help ensure that the team members are aligned on what tasks are done, where things are, and how any impediments can be addressed. It would be necessary for the work of a Scrum Manager to help prioritise tasks - which would signal the completion of the most important activities - and the least effort would go into distraction or work that is not required as well as totally unnecessary.

One of the often-forgotten duties of a Scrum Manager is bridging the gaps between stakeholders and the development teams. This assigned role makes sure that whatever work the project does aligns itself with business objectives and with stakeholders' expectations. They manage to do so through constant communications with stakeholders during sprint reviews, progress reports, and updates on project milestones. Stakeholders love visibility in projects, and this is something a Scrum Manager provides. They ensure that stakeholders know whatever has been achieved, what problems the team is facing, and what is ahead. It builds trust and allows giving feedback in time, which can change the course of the project. The Scrum Manager also ensures that stakeholders can have realistic expectation dimensions on timelines, resources, and deliverables. Hence, setting up clear remediation and communication makes misunderstandings/dissatisfaction less likely.
A unique feature in the scrum methodology has been continuous improvement. By enabling retrospective meetings at the end of each sprint, the Scrum Manager shall cause discussions on what has worked well, what has not, and what can be improved. These become safe spaces for constructive feedback, and the team can then identify inefficiencies and solve them together. By encouraging that iterative approach, a Scrum Manager shores up the refinement of processes and practices over time by the team. The improvement objective raises productivity and well prepares the team to face any emerging challenges. Be it new tools, refined workflows, or improved communication strategies, an incremental change is being created on each of these that is expected to generate long-term benefits.
